The "Pitch in the Trades": Apply now
The "Future of Crafts" congress in March 2026 will once again feature a "Pitch in Crafts." The best ideas for tomorrow are being sought. Applications are now being accepted.

Will you get a deal or not? That's the exciting question in the pitch on "Shark Tank." The "Pitch in the Trades" competition also revolves around convincing a top-class jury. Six finalists from the skilled trades have the chance to participate in the March 4, 2026 live on stage by "Future Crafts" to compete against each other in Munich. The search is on for the best and most forward-looking ideas in the skilled trades. There will be an audience award and a jury award – each worth €5.000. Accommodation in Munich is included for the finalists.
The focus in 2026 will be on these topics:
✓ Corporate management: Succession, handover, business start-up
✓ Staff: Securing skilled workers and attracting talent
✓ AI in the workplace: Robotics and corporate management
All submissions should again be under the motto "Proud to create in the craft." to stand.
The projects and ideas should have been implemented for at least six months. They should demonstrate how a viable solution was developed from a challenge, according to the organizers.
The jury pays attention to
✓ Degree of innovation,
✓ Feasibility,
✓ Relevance to the focus topics,
✓ Benefits for the trades and
✓ Transferability to other companies.

This is how the pitch process works in the skilled trades:
The six finalists with the most votes will compete on March 4, 2026 live on stage They compete against each other. They each have five minutes for their pitch and five minutes to answer the jury's questions.
The audience and jury then vote to determine who wins the jury prize and the audience prize – with a total prize money of EUR 5.000The prize money is donated by the Association for the Promotion of Crafts. All participants receive a day ticket, the finalists... two day tickets and one hotel night.
This is the jury for 2026
- Jörg Dittrich, President of the Central Association of German Crafts
- Franz-Xaver Peteranderl, President of the Chamber of Skilled Crafts for Munich and Upper Bavaria
- Katja Lilu Melder, Federal Chairwoman of Women Entrepreneurs in Crafts
- Sara Hofmann, Federal Chairwoman of the Young Craftsmen
"We look forward to many conceptually strong and pragmatic ideas that will help shape the craft and society of tomorrow," said Bettina Reiter, Director of the Future of Crafts.
